Seven students (4-Male & 3-Female) from Karagwe University College(KARUCO) in Karagwe district, Karagwe region and one student from Sokoine University of Agriculture(SUA) who is undertaking her Bachelor degree in Agricultural Economics and Agribusiness has benefited by being trained on different research programs being carried out at TARI-Ukiriguru Centre based in Mwanza region. During their one month presence at TARI Ukiriguru the students were practically involved in activities done by researchers at the Institute in particular areas of agronomy, breeding, entomology, pathology of the mandated crops like root crops(sweet potato& cassava) and cotton as well as non-mandated crops like sun flower, sorghum, maize, paddy and leguminous crops like chickpea.

Students were also trained on tractor maintenance and operations. Practically, they managed to drive a tractor both forward and reverse ways, including hitching the farm implements (disc plough, disc harrow and a ridger). Finally, they were able to make ploughing using a tractor
